Computer Generated Celtic Knotwork using L-system Graphics,
Dave Carroll and Mike Scott.
In any domain where objects are sufficiently regular there may be an opportunity to develop a grammar based model of their geometric structure. One such domain is Celtic knot work particularly knot work of the type found in Celtic manuscripts such as the Book of Kells. Modelling such knot work using a grammar based approach based on L-systems is the subject of this paper. The paper describes the addition of a curve drawing construct to L-systems to allow the encoding of curved figures. A construct is developed which enables Bezier curves to be drawn using L-systems. This construct is used to model Celtic knot patterns. The patterns are encoded in an L-system and used as meta-patterns to construct simple carpet-pages made up of multiple knot patterns. A prototype production rule system and graphics interpreter for L-system strings using turtle graphics is also described. The problem of under-crossing and over-crossing of knot cords is addressed using Z-axis perturbation. This enables the generation of self-avoiding curves in three-space to give realistic looking knot patterns in 3D.

Coxeter, H(arold) S(cott) M(acDonald)
British-born Canadian geometer
(b. Feb. 9, 1907, London, Eng.?. March 31, 2003, Toronto, Ont.),
was a leader in the understanding of
non-Euclidean geometries,
reflection patterns,
and polytopes (higher-dimensional analogs of three-dimensional polyhedra).
His work served as an inspiration for R. Buckminster Fuller's concept of
the geodesic dome and, particularly, for the intricate geometric·
